Now we begin to reclaim our Softness.  

For many of us the idea of being soft is somewhat repulsive.  We may associate the idea of softness with weakness, with "being a victim"; we don't associate softness with strength, or being powerful, or being a warrior.

I hear you. In the past I struggled with softness, a lot, and still do a much lesser degree still.

Softness can be vulnerable.  In fact, it is vulnerable.  But vulnerability is not weakness.  Vulnerability isn't about meekness.  Vulnerability is truly about strength.

Softness allows connection.  It allows bending and swaying while not breaking.  It allows gentleness and comfort and understanding.

All things our rigid armor prevents on many levels, in many ways.

Going deep into softness is also terrifying (yes, this whole journey has many terrifying parts!). It requires us to learn to sit with discomfort, not only ours but also another person's and not shame or try to "fix" or block or stuff down.
